Introductory Geology


Overview

Foundational Knowledge: Introduces essential geological concepts, including minerals, rocks, plate tectonics, and Earth surface processes. Process-Oriented Understanding: Explains dynamic Earth systems such as volcanism, earthquakes, erosion, and sediment cycles in a clear and engaging manner. Applied Geological Skills: Covers basic field methods, geological mapping, fossil study, and interpretation techniques commonly used in geology. Connection to Modern Issues: Highlights the role of geology in addressing climate change, natural hazards, environmental management, and resource sustainability. Student-Friendly Presentation: Employs accessible language, illustrations, and structured explanations to support foundational learning in earth sciences.
